Wong Tung Hon is a 75-year-old rusticated survivor, who escaped China during the cultural revolution. He was one of the students who got sent down to the countryside. Wong gave an audience to the sounds of the bristly waves rippling at the reefs; on the opposite shore were the gravitating buildings of Shenzhen, gazing at the trifling monument for the sent-down youth who lost their lives during their escape from China to Hong Kong. He was deep in his thoughts. That year, the flashback of Wong fleeing nervously and lifting anchor on a dark cold night is vividly evoked after 50 long years….
